本文介绍了一个受多次采动压力影响的大跨度、大断面、多交叉点冒落硐室修复工程中进行锚、网、喷联合支护的研究与实践。通过对围岩破坏机理分析,根据围岩松动圈支护原理,采用锚、网、喷联合支护,选择合理的支护参数,由锚杆、混凝土喷层、金属网与围岩的共同作用实现维护的目的,成功地进行了修复施工。
